Aims. We update the constraints on the time variation of the fine structure constant α and the electron mass me, using the latest CMB data, including the 7-yr release of WMAP.
Methods. We made statistical analyses of the variation of each one of the constants and of their joint variation, together with the basic set of cosmological parameters. We used a modified version of CAMB and COSMOMC to account for these possible variations.
Results. We present bounds on the variation of the constants for different
data sets, and show how results depend on them. When using the
latest CMB data plus the power spectrum from Sloan Digital Sky
Survey LRG, we find that α/ = 0.986 ± 0.007 at
1-σ level, when the 6 basic cosmological parameters were
fitted, and only variation in α was allowed. The constraints
in the case of variation of both constants are α/
=
0.986 ± 0.009 and me/me0 = 0.999 ± 0.035. In the case
of only variation in me, the bound is m e/me0 = 0.964 ±
0.025.
